
要自制一款工业生产管理软件设备,有以下几点关键步骤:1、确定需求,2、选择开发工具,3、设计系统架构,4、开发与测试,5、部署与维护。接下来,我们将详细探讨其中的一个关键点——确定需求。
确定需求是任何软件开发的第一步,因为它直接决定了软件的功能和用户体验。在确定需求时,需要充分了解工业生产中的各种流程和痛点。通过与工厂管理人员和一线员工的深入沟通,明确哪些环节需要信息化管理,哪些数据需要实时监控,以及哪些操作需要自动化处理。只有在了解了这些具体的需求后,才能设计出切实有效的软件功能,满足实际使用中的各种需求。
一、确定需求
-
需求调研
1.1 与工厂管理人员沟通,了解现有管理模式和存在的问题。
1.2 走访生产现场,观察生产流程和设备运转情况。
1.3 收集一线员工的意见,了解他们在日常操作中的痛点和需求。
-
需求分析
2.1 将收集到的信息进行分类,提炼出核心需求。
2.2 对每个需求进行重要性和紧急程度评估。
-
需求文档
3.1 编写详细的需求文档,描述每个功能模块的具体要求。
3.2 需求文档应包括功能描述、操作流程、数据输入输出、用户权限等内容。
3.3 需求文档需与相关人员确认,确保无遗漏和误解。
二、选择开发工具
-
编程语言
1.1 根据软件的功能需求和团队的技术水平选择合适的编程语言,如Java、Python、C#等。
1.2 对于实时性要求较高的系统,可以考虑使用C/C++等高性能语言。
-
开发框架
2.1 选择成熟的开发框架可以提高开发效率和系统稳定性,如Spring、Django、.NET等。
2.2 考虑框架的扩展性和社区支持,确保后续维护和升级的便利性。
-
数据库
3.1 根据数据量和访问频率选择合适的数据库管理系统,如MySQL、PostgreSQL、MongoDB等。
3.2 考虑数据库的事务处理能力和容灾备份机制,确保数据的安全性和可靠性。
三、设计系统架构
-
模块划分
1.1 将软件需求分解成多个功能模块,如生产计划、设备管理、质量控制等。
1.2 确定各模块的功能和接口,确保模块间的协作和数据共享。
-
系统架构图
2.1 绘制系统架构图,展示各模块的关系和数据流向。
2.2 明确系统的核心组件和技术选型,如服务器、数据库、中间件等。
-
安全设计
3.1 考虑系统的安全需求,设计权限控制和数据加密机制。
3.2 制定安全策略和应急预案,防范潜在的安全风险。
四、开发与测试
-
代码编写
1.1 根据需求文档和系统架构图,开始编写代码。
1.2 遵循编码规范和设计原则,确保代码的可读性和可维护性。
-
单元测试
2.1 为每个功能模块编写单元测试用例,确保模块功能的正确性。
2.2 运行单元测试,修复发现的问题,保证代码质量。
-
集成测试
3.1 将各功能模块集成在一起,进行集成测试。
3.2 测试模块间的协作和数据流动,确保系统的整体功能。
-
用户测试
4.1 邀请工厂管理人员和一线员工进行用户测试,收集反馈意见。
4.2 根据用户反馈进行调整和优化,提升用户体验。
五、部署与维护
-
系统部署
1.1 根据系统架构图,准备服务器、数据库等部署环境。
1.2 安装和配置软件,将系统部署上线。
-
数据迁移
2.1 将现有的生产数据迁移到新系统中,确保数据的完整性和一致性。
2.2 验证数据迁移的结果,确保数据无误。
-
系统维护
3.1 制定系统维护计划,定期进行系统检查和优化。
3.2 监控系统运行状态,及时处理故障和问题。
-
用户培训
4.1 对工厂管理人员和一线员工进行系统使用培训,确保他们能够熟练操作。
4.2 提供系统使用手册和技术支持,帮助用户解决使用中的问题。
总结来说,自制工业生产管理软件设备需要从需求调研开始,经过选择开发工具、设计系统架构、开发与测试,最终部署与维护。每一个步骤都至关重要,且需要细致认真地完成。对于企业来说,采用专业的工具和平台可以大大提高效率和质量,推荐使用简道云平台,它提供了丰富的开发工具和灵活的配置选项,能够有效支持工业生产管理系统的开发与实施。简道云官网: https://s.fanruan.com/fnuw2;
进一步建议,企业在开发过程中应保持与业务部门的紧密沟通,确保软件功能能够真正满足生产管理的需求。同时,定期进行系统更新和优化,持续提升系统性能和用户体验。
相关问答FAQs:
自制工业生产管理软件设备的优势是什么?
自制工业生产管理软件设备可以根据企业特定需求进行定制,提供灵活性和适应性。企业可以根据生产流程和管理需求,开发出符合自身业务特点的软件。这种定制化的软件可以有效提升生产效率,优化资源配置,减少不必要的成本支出。此外,自制软件可以在功能上不断迭代和更新,以满足企业在不同发展阶段的变化需求,确保管理系统始终处于最佳状态。
如何开始自制工业生产管理软件设备的开发?
开发自制工业生产管理软件设备的第一步是明确需求分析。这包括与各部门沟通,了解他们在生产管理中面临的挑战和需求。接下来,制定开发计划,确定软件的功能模块,例如生产计划管理、库存管理、质量控制等。之后,选择合适的技术栈和开发团队,进行软件的设计和开发。在开发过程中,持续进行测试和反馈,以确保软件的稳定性和功能的有效性。最后,实施培训和上线,确保用户能够熟练掌握软件的使用。
自制工业生产管理软件设备的维护和更新应该如何进行?
维护和更新自制工业生产管理软件设备是确保其长期有效运行的重要环节。企业需要定期评估软件的使用情况,收集用户反馈,了解软件在实际操作中的表现。针对发现的问题,及时进行修复和优化。更新方面,企业应定期检讨功能需求,随着业务的变化进行版本升级,增加新功能或改进现有功能。同时,备份数据和系统,以防止因突发状况造成的数据丢失。通过定期的维护和更新,确保软件始终能够支持企业的生产管理需求。
自制工业生产管理软件设备不仅能够提升工作效率,还能为企业带来竞争优势。通过合理的开发与管理,企业可以不断适应市场变化,实现可持续发展。
推荐100+企业管理系统模板免费使用>>>无需下载,在线安装:
地址: https://s.fanruan.com/7wtn5;
阅读时间:5 分钟
浏览量:2845次





























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








